The Art of Puzzle Design in Adventure Games
The quality of puzzles is often the defining factor in the success of these types of simulations. A well-designed puzzle should be challenging but not frustrating, requiring players to think critically and apply their knowledge of the game world. The most effective puzzles are organically integrated into the narrative, feeling like a natural extension of the environment rather than arbitrary obstacles. They often draw inspiration from real-world historical or mythological elements, adding a layer of authenticity and intrigue. Moreover, the puzzles should offer a sense of satisfaction upon completion, rewarding players with valuable clues or access to new areas. Avoiding overly obscure or illogical solutions is crucial; puzzles should be solvable through careful observation and logical deduction, not through random guessing.
Types of Puzzles Commonly Found in Exploration Games
A variety of puzzle types contribute to the diverse gameplay seen in these immersive experiences. These can include logic puzzles that demand deductive reasoning, pattern recognition puzzles that require identifying recurring sequences, and spatial reasoning puzzles that challenge players to manipulate objects in three-dimensional space. Mechanical puzzles, involving the manipulation of gears, levers, and other physical components, are also common, offering a tactile and engaging experience. Code-breaking puzzles, where players must decipher encrypted messages, add an element of mystery and intellectual challenge. Furthermore, environmental puzzles, which require players to interact with the surrounding environment to trigger a desired outcome, encourage exploration and observation. A skillful blending of these puzzle types ensures the gameplay remains fresh and engaging throughout the adventure.
- Logic Puzzles: Focus on deductive reasoning.
- Pattern Recognition: Identifying repeating sequences.
- Spatial Reasoning: Manipulating objects in 3D space.
- Code Breaking: Deciphering encrypted messages.
The creative application of these different puzzle mechanics helps to set apart exceptional simulations from the more commonplace examples.

The Psychological Appeal of Treasure Hunting
The enduring appeal of treasure hunting simulations taps into several fundamental psychological principles. The thrill of the unknown and the anticipation of discovery activate the brain’s reward system, releasing dopamine and creating a sense of excitement and pleasure. The element of challenge and problem-solving provides a sense of accomplishment and boosts self-esteem. The simulated risk-taking involved in these games allows players to experience a sense of adventure without facing any real-world consequences. Furthermore, the fantasy of uncovering hidden riches appeals to our innate desire for wealth and status. The immersive nature of these simulations provides a temporary escape from the stresses of everyday life, allowing players to lose themselves in a world of fantasy and adventure.
